Publisher's Synopsis

When beautiful cloth merchant's daughter Elizabeth Williams is widowed at the age of twenty-two, she is determined to succeed in the business she has learned from her father. But many are opposed to a woman making her own way in the world, and Elizabeth could have powerful enemies - enemies who know the truth about her late husband. Then Elizabeth meets kindly, ambitious merchant turned lawyer, Thomas Cromwell. Their marriage is based on mutual love and respect ... but it isn't easy being the wife of an influential, headstrong man in Henry VIII?s London. The city is filled with ruthless people and strange delights - and Elizabeth must adjust to the life she has chosen, or risk losing everything.
